Technical Analysis

The HP Fan Control App contains an unquoted search path vulnerability (CWE-428) that could allow a local attacker with limited privileges to escalate their privileges. This vulnerability arises from improper handling of executable search paths, potentially enabling execution of malicious code with elevated rights. The CVSS 4.0 score is 7.3 (high), reflecting local attack vector, low attack complexity, and significant imp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ability. Although an updated version has been released to address this issue, no specific patch version or remediation instructions are included in the provided information.

Potential Impact

A local attacker with limited privileges could exploit this vulnerability to escalate their privileges on the system, potentially gaining higher-level access than intended. This could lead to unauthorized access to sensitive information, modification of system settings, or disruption of system availability. The vulnerability does not require user interaction and has a high imp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ability.

Mitigation Recommendations

An updated version of the HP Fan Control App has been released to mitigate this vulnerability. However, the exact patch or remediation details are not provided in the available data. Users and administrators should consult HP's official advisory or support channels to obtain and apply the updated version of the HP Fan Control App. Until the update is applied, restricting local user permissions and monitoring for suspicious activity may help reduce risk.
